WebJun 20, 2024 · Sorø. Sorø is a peaceful picturesque city located on Zealand Island on the east of Denmark and was founded in 1161 by Bishop Absalon. The small town is known for being the site of Sorø Academy, a boarding school that was built in the 12th century and was used as a monastery, an educational institution, and a venue for Golden Age artists.
